Andean blackberry

Cultivated wild berry; ideal for pulps, jams, and juices.

Andean blackberry (Rubus glaucus) is a deep black berry with acidic notes, highly prized in juices, nectars, and confectionery. Ecuador is one of the main Andean producers. Exported fresh in short season or as IQF frozen pulp year-round. High anthocyanin and vitamin C content.

Origin
Cotopaxi, Tungurahua & Chimborazo, Ecuador
Harvest season
March – September
Export specifications
IQF pulp · Brix 8–11 · 10 kg bag packaging

Ideal for

Clamshell retail, pastry, ice cream, smoothies, confectionery, and healthy toppings.

Storage & handling

0–4 °C, 90–95% RH. Do not wash before refrigeration; use or process within 5–10 days.

Preparation

Wash gently only before consumption; remove stems if needed. Ideal for immediate IQF after sorting.

Vitamins & minerals

Vitamin C, anthocyanins, fiber, manganese, and vitamin K.
